Securing Your BMS: A Guide to Digital Safety Best Practices
Protecting your Building Management System (BMS) is critical in today's ever-growing digital world. A compromised BMS can lead to significant disruption, financial losses, and even real safety risks . Implementing comprehensive digital protection best practices is not just an option; it’s a necessity . Here’s a quick guide assisting you safeguard your system:
- Regularly update firmware and fix flaws.
- Enforce strong, unique passwords and several-factor authentication .
- Isolate your network to limit access and prevent potential compromises.
- Conduct periodic security audits to identify likely threats .
- Inform your personnel about phishing attacks and safe cyber practices.
Remember, a forward-thinking approach to BMS safeguarding is crucial to preserving operational continuity and securing your facility ’s assets .

{BMS Digital Safety Checklist: Essential Steps for Protecting Your Infrastructure
Maintaining secure Building Management System (BMS) digital security is crucial in today's digital world. here Neglecting potential vulnerabilities can lead to critical disruptions and financial losses. This overview outlines important steps to protect your BMS environment . Begin by evaluating your current system for potential risks. Subsequently, enforce strong password policies and multi-factor authentication for all user accounts. Regularly perform software updates and patch control to address emerging threats. Furthermore, create network segmentation to isolate the BMS from other business networks. Think about implementing intrusion avoidance systems and employing consistent security audits .
